Output cf3bb60be5e374aa01d07271733e4fcc9d15e7d9b35ff1d39b07580083691522:3

value
1014048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5dc3993e2f3fcef0743e07c5a0468722c656452 OP_EQUAL
address
3JGc3m3kfZRZ3TfLH2vamfeqb2FvzCkb7X
transaction
cf3bb60be5e374aa01d07271733e4fcc9d15e7d9b35ff1d39b07580083691522
spent
true